Output 73de50fd423632c7b03f7c683174a24ea22fc70d9c39a22ba934adbdcbc64a18:0

value
6974100596125
script pubkey
OP_0 OP_PUSHBYTES_20 987ec381078818141cc885032ef5a4b4a46b60f4
address
tb1qnplv8qg83qvpg8xgs5pjaadykjjxkc85wvgdnj
transaction
73de50fd423632c7b03f7c683174a24ea22fc70d9c39a22ba934adbdcbc64a18
confirmations
186887
spent
true